Turning on the Power and Selecting the Clock

The first time you plug the power cord into an outlet, or after there has been an interruprion in power, the display shows after ten seconds

1 Press the Clock button.

2 Use the number buttons to enter the current time.

You must press at least three numbers to set the clock. For example, if the current time is 5:00, enter 5,0,0.

The display will show: 500

3 Press Clock again. A colon will appear, indicating that the time is set.

If there is a power interruption, you will need to reset the clock.

You can check the current time while cooking is in progress by pressing the Clock button.

Using the Kitchen Timer

1 Press the Kitchen Timer button.

2 Use the Number buttons to set the length of time you want the timer to run.

3 Press the Start button.

4 The display counts down and beeps when the time has elapsed.

Using the One Minute + Button

This button offers a convenient way to heat food in one minute incre- ments at the High power level.

1 Press the One Minute+ button once for each minute you wish to cook the food. For example, press it twice for two minutes.

The time will display, and the oven starts automatically.

Add minutes to a program in progress by pressing the One Minute+ but- ton for each minute you want to add.

Using the Pause/Cancel Button

The Pause/Cancel button allows you to clear instructions you have entered. It also allows you to pause the oven’s cooking cycle, so that you can check the food.

To pause the oven during cooking : press Pause/Cancel button once. To restart, press Start button.

To stop cooking, erase instructions, and return the oven display to the time of day: press Pause/Cancel button twice.

To clear instructions you have just entered: press Pause/Cancel button once, then re-enter the instructions.

To cancel a timer setting: press Pause/Cancel button once.

Turning the Light On/Off

Press Light button to turn the Light On/Off.

Turning the Vent Fan On/Off

The vent fan removes steam and other vapors from surface cooking. Press Vent button to turn the Vent fan On/Off.

Note

The Vent Fan protects the microwave from too much heat rising from the cooktop below it. It automatically turns on at low speed if it senses too much heat.

2 If you have turned the fan on, you may find that you cannot turn it off. The fan will automatically turn off when the internal parts are cool. It may stay on for 30 minutes or more after the cooktop and microwave controls are turned off.
